Based on the given scenario, where Plant 2 is a parasite of Plant 1, the graph that best predicts the growth of Plant 1 and Plant 2 during the experiment would be graph C.

Graph C shows that initially, when the plants are grown together, both Plant 1 and Plant 2 experience growth. However, after they are separated, the growth of Plant 1 continues, while the growth of Plant 2 declines. This pattern reflects the relationship between a host plant (Plant 1) and a parasite (Plant 2), where the parasite's growth is dependent on the host's resources. Once separated, Plant 2 loses access to the resources provided by Plant 1 and consequently experiences a decrease in growth.

Therefore, graph C is the most suitable representation of the scenario described.
